WebRelationship with employer. W-2 employees are often hired indefinitely for ongoing, consistent work. They are also afforded protections under the law, such as minimum wage, overtime, and family and medical leave. Meanwhile, independent contractors agree to work for an employer for a specific period of time and are not afforded the same legal ... WebNov 21, 2024 · Employers must file Copy A of Form (s) W-2 to the Social Security Administration by January 31st. If January 31st falls on a Saturday, Sunday, or legal holiday, the deadline will be the next business day. Employers must furnish Copies B, C, and 2 of Form W-2 to employees by January 31. WebMar 10, 2009 · Usually, the employer asks new hires to fill out all of their paperwork on the first day of work, including the employee's new W-4 (withholding allowance calculator). Since it is possible to see what you claimed on your last W-4 by looking at your old W-2, the person who handles payroll might want to use the W-2 to help you fill out your new W-4. WebAug 30, 2024 · Yes, but an actual copy of your Form W-2 is only available if you submitted it with a paper tax return:. Transcript. You can get a wage and income transcript, containing the Federal tax information your employer reported to the Social Security Administration (SSA), by visiting our Get Your Tax Record page. WebThe Low-priced Care Act demand employers up report the cost of coverage under an employer-sponsored group health plan. Reporting an cost of fitness care coverage over the Form W-2 does not mean that the coverage are taxable.
